'+' or '-'), the collection element itself is used in comparisons. To dynamically sort a particular column, click on its column header. rev2022.11.7.43013. order by ascending descending in angular 6 on click of button. options: object: Specifies whether this FormArray instance should . Fork. Declarative templates with data-binding, MVC, dependency injection and great testability story all implemented with pure client-side JavaScript! using *ngIf directive, We can use the function to check truthy values. Print the sorted array of strings. Change only in the comparison part for descending order. You may think it as a key name. Find centralized, trusted content and collaborate around the technologies you use most. I am using the following: const result= _.sortBy(_.where(this.sampleArray, 'ID')).reverse(); But this is not reliable as the ID order keep on changing from descending to ascending. How to detect when an @Input() value changes in Angular? Complete code Here, Just pass a function to the sort, based on which you want to sort the array. The comparison function that will be able to sort dates must firstly convert string representations of dates into Date objects and then compare two dates in the desired way. This sorting component can sort any type of data in a table like alphanumeric, string, number, and date. Angular KeyValue Pipe Default sorting. Euler integration of the three-body problem. How can I jump to a given year on the Google Calendar application on my Google Pixel 6 phone? Sort using Zone(Descending) then by BranchName . Now lets create a directive which we will configure in Table header for sorting according to a specific column.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. So that covers the configuration part for sorting in the table using the directive approach. An example of data being processed may be a unique identifier stored in a cookie. array sort in angular 6 Code Example October 5, 2021 7:55 AM / Javascript array sort in angular 6 Tanveer Ali array.sort ( (a,b) => a.title.rendered.localeCompare (b.title.rendered)); Add Own solution Log in, to leave a comment Are there any code examples left? Full Stack Developer in Various Tech, Code Quotient. Search. Fix for Object is possibly null or undefined in typescript? Now lets give a look to sort.directive.ts how it is working. Directly Date object can not be compared, Instead, we have to use the Date.getTime function and === operator. in angular 9, Error: Can't resolve 'core-js/es7/reflect' in '\node_modules\@angular-devkit\build-angular\src\angular-cli-files\models. If omitted, the array is sorted lexicographically. React Button Click event handler with example, Scaffold a New React Application using create-react-app | ReactJS Cli tutorials. error TS7006: Parameter a implicitly has an any type.if(typeof ez_ad_units!='undefined'){ez_ad_units.push([[300,250],'cloudhadoop_com-large-leaderboard-2','ezslot_10',124,'0','0'])};__ez_fad_position('div-gpt-ad-cloudhadoop_com-large-leaderboard-2-0'); Learn different examples for comparing two dates that are equal and comparing future and given dates with current dates. angular kendo grid field array angular kendo grid field array In the given example the date format is dd/mm/yyyy and the record is sorted with respect to address. How do I pass data to Angular routed components? Find the lowest value: const points = [40, 100, 1, 5, 25, 10]; // Sort the numbers in ascending order. custom table sorting in angular 8. This dovetails perfectly with the Array.prototype.sort () method, which uses exactly these types of ranges to determine how to sort the items within a collection. Asking for help, clarification, or responding to other answers. angular2-routing angular2-template angular5 angular6 angular7 angular8 angular9 angular10 angular11 angular12 angularjs angularjs-e2e api arrays bootstrap-4 c# css discord.js django . How do I check whether an array contains a string in TypeScript? Traverse the array. To sort an ArrayList using Comparator override the compare method provided by the comparator interface. Typescript String - Complete tutorials with examples, Typescript - Beginner Guide to type keyword with example, Typescript - Object Type and Object with examples, Typescript Guide to Decorators with code examples, How do you create a Date object in Angular, Compare two dates without time in Angular. Some coworkers are committing to work overtime for a 1% bonus. Angular 6 Migration -.angular-cli.json to angular.json, What's alternative to angular.copy in Angular, I am new to angular. Starter project for Angular apps that exports to the Angular CLI StackBlitz. Copyright Cloudhadoop.com 2022. If the result is 0, no changes are done with the sort order of the two values. how to sort array in descending order based on a field in typescript; sort array by value typescript descending; array order by desc ts; angular sort desc typescript; typescript sort descending number array; arr.sort string typescript; typescript sort array of objects by number descending; array sort string angular; array.sort typescript . Are witnesses allowed to give private testimonies? Protecting Threads on a thru-axle dropout. Following is the example of orderby filter in angularjs to sort array items in both ascending order and descending order. How to use Angular TypeScript to order them in descending order. Return Value. See the difference between both compare functions.. "/> Some of our partners may process your data as a part of their legitimate business interest without asking for consent. The sort pipe takes 4 arguments:The results of the filter pipe, the direction of sorting i.e ascending or descending,the type of column to sort i.e string or numeric and also the column to be . 503), Mobile app infrastructure being decommissioned, 2022 Moderator Election Q&A Question Collection. sort array without using sort function in javascript. How do I dynamically assign properties to an object in TypeScript? Angular 6 Sort Array Of Object By Date. Find centralized, trusted content and collaborate around the technologies you use most. We will create a reusable component that will sort the tables rows. The orderBy pipe. How to Sort an Array of JSON objects with a date key in Angular? Stack Overflow for Teams is moving to its own domain! How to generate GUID in Typescript with code examples. 00962795525052. When you click on any table header following things are happening concurrently, Check out the Github repository for Source Code. We have added the orderBy filter which will sort the array records by the branchName field in Ascending Order. Returns a sorted array. Like this article? If he wanted control of the company, why didn't Elon Musk buy 51% of Twitter shares instead of 100%? Toggle navigation. I want to write a code in php which will sort the nilai_pengetahuan on my array in a txt file in ascending and descending order on clicking the respective . Covariant derivative vs Ordinary derivative. Array Sort method sort the arrays in ascending or descending order. function (a, b) { // Convert string dates into `Date` objects const date1 = new Date (a); const . Love podcasts or audiobooks? javascript sort array of objects by key value ascending and descending order. bundle.js 404, useEffect React Hook rendering multiple times with async await (submit button), Axios Node.Js GET request with params is undefined. Lets start with creating an angular project, Now grab bootstrap CSS and JS CDN from https://getbootstrap.com/ and place it in index.html in the following sequence, Now create a component named table using the following command. sort by ascending javascript. How to trigger file removal with FilePond, Change the position of Tabs' indicator in Material UI, How to Use Firebase Phone Authentication without recaptcha in React Native, Could not proxy request from localhost:3000 to localhost:7000 ReactJs. I am using underscore library Sign in. By default, the .localeCompare () method treats embedded numbers as strings. Not the answer you're looking for? The Grid component has support to sort data bound columns in ascending or descending order. 503), Mobile app infrastructure being decommissioned, 2022 Moderator Election Q&A Question Collection, Angular 2 @ViewChild annotation returns undefined, access key and value of object using *ngFor. Share. Step 7 - PHP Service API. For ascending order we applied orderBy:'name' to ng-repeat and for descending . Array.prototype.sort () The sort () method sorts the elements of an array in place and returns the reference to the same array, now sorted. Guy Veraghtert unread, I know it might seem little confusing, however, remember In multi-column sort, a sort of order made previously must not get damaged by the next sort orders. import all utilities using the import keyword an animal object has key-id, name, and values Go to http://localhost:4200 and the result will be like following, Now lets create a folder util inside the app folder and create a sort.ts file inside the util folder, Now place the following code in sort.ts file. Connect and share knowledge within a single location that is structured and easy to search. Thankfully, the Date constructor accepts a wide variety of formats, and can translate them to an easily comparable format:. Go to http://localhost:4200, Lets create an array of IEmployee type inside table.component.ts, Now lets create a table in table.component.html iterating over this dataList array. Share it on Social Media. reverse. typescript sort array descending. We and our partners use data for Personalised ads and content, ad and content measurement, audience insights and product development. We and our partners use cookies to Store and/or access information on a device. I will describe how the directive will be integrated with this algo after implementation. order by pipe in angular, angular orderby, angular orderby pipe example, ascending and descending sort in angular. Sometimes, We want to compare the Current date with future dates. We can also use other relational operators. rev2022.11.7.43013. By default, sorting is disabled. Is it enough to verify the hash to ensure file is virus free? sort ( (a,b) => b - a) Stackblitz 10 Suren Srapyan Your code this .display= this .addition.sort (); if(typeof ez_ad_units!='undefined'){ez_ad_units.push([[250,250],'cloudhadoop_com-medrectangle-4','ezslot_5',137,'0','0'])};__ez_fad_position('div-gpt-ad-cloudhadoop_com-medrectangle-4-0');Here is html component. 'typescript': { Angular Material 9/8 DataTable columns with each having its own separate filter, we are going to learn with an example tutorial in this post. Not the answer you're looking for? Filter is an important part in AngularJS as well as Angular 2 or Angular 4. Do FTDI serial port chips use a soft UART, or a hardware UART? Override the compare method in such a way that it will reorder an ArrayList in descending order instead of ascending order. Lets create an angular application and create a new component array-json-dates.component. Now lets do npm start or ng serve in command prompt from the project directory, although both will start the angular project. Do FTDI serial port chips use a soft UART, or a hardware UART?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. To use this component zero configuration required in any component.ts file. Are witnesses allowed to give private testimonies? Already on GitHub? Will Nondetection prevent an Alarm spell from triggering? sun joe spx3000 pressure washer instructions.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. In other words, this filter selects a subset (a smaller array containing elements that meet the filter criteria) of an array from the original array.01-Aug-2022, One can use filter() function in JavaScript to filter the object array based on attributes. Unsubscribe any time. Optional. Can plants use Light from Aurora Borealis to Photosynthesize? javascript sort array of objects ascending and descending order. How to Sort array of objects by a property value. Sort an array by both ascending and descending order in js. The time and space complexity of the sort cannot be . immutable js sort ascending and descending order. How does reproducing other labs' results work? Did the words "come" and "home" historically rhyme? 5 lessons learned when I TDD an algorithm in JavaScript, JavaScript 30Day 5Flex Panel Gallery, If the property that needs to be sorted is a, The header, we are clicking on is stored in, Now get the initial order of that header using, Now get the property type of that header using, Now get the property name that needs to be sorted in that list using. Angular typescript component:if(typeof ez_ad_units!='undefined'){ez_ad_units.push([[250,250],'cloudhadoop_com-box-4','ezslot_4',121,'0','0'])};__ez_fad_position('div-gpt-ad-cloudhadoop_com-box-4-0'); In Typescript, We have written function isDateEqual() which check for date comparison. Is it worth to migrate from Angular 2 to Angular 4? Now open sort.directive.ts and replace existing code with the following code.